The CRB15025 is a crossed roller bearing with a 150mm bore and 210mm outer diameter, crafted from sturdy steel for reliable performance. Its compact 25mm width makes it suitable for space-conscious applications.
This bearing handles combined loads up to 76.8 kN, offering smooth operation in temperatures from 0°C to 110°C. The press-fit shaft mount ensures secure installation in various setups.
Its open design simplifies lubrication, while the steel rollers provide lasting durability. The bearing meets ABEC5 precision standards, with options for higher grades available.
Ideal for rotary tables or industrial automation, this 3.16kg unit complies with RoHS and REACH regulations. The crossed roller design delivers excellent stability under demanding conditions.
